Required Education, Experience, & Skills:
We are actively seeking Systems Engineers to perform as a Splunk Cloud engineer with a minimum of 11 years' experience. Information Technology or Engineer Bachelor's or Master's Degrees are preferred. Specific skills should include the following:
Experience integrating diverse data streams
Experience with data transfer tools (Ex: NiFi, Cribl, etc)
Establishes data standards and acts as custodian of IT and service delivery data sets and streams
Experience in analyzing complex networks and systems
Experience in analyzing log data from various network components and operating systems
Knowledge of complex environments involving shared networks and multiple security enclaves
Systems Engineer with Data Engineer background
Ability to manage and troubleshoot data feeds
Splunk familiarization
Python
Required Qualifications
Experience: 6+ years working with Splunk or Splunk Certifications, with at least 3 years on Splunk Cloud or large Splunk Enterprise deployments.
Technical Skills: Expert SPL, knowledge of Splunk apps (Enterprise Security, ITSI, DB Connect), forwarder architectures, indexer/search head concepts.
Cloud & Observability: Hands on experience onboarding data from AWS, Azure, and/or Google Cloud Platform; familiarity and observability tooling.
Automation: Proficiency CloudFormation and experience integrating Splunk deployments into CI/CD.
Scripting: Strong Python and Bash skills for automation, integrations, and ingestion pipelines.
Security Knowledge: Understanding of logging best practices, log retention requirements, secure transport, and common compliance frameworks.
Soft Skills: Strong troubleshooting, stakeholder communication, project leadership, and mentoring capability.
Preferred Education, Experience, & Skills:
Splunk Certified Cloud Architect, Splunk Certified Admin, or Splunk Certified Power User.
Cloud certifications (AWS/Azure/Google Cloud Platform).
Experience with observability frameworks (OpenTelemetry), metrics pipelines, and metric-to-log correlation.
Prior experience operating at enterprise scale (multi TB ingestion/day, global deployments).
Proficiency with Terraform, Ansible, or similar IaC tools and experience integrating Splunk deployments into CI/CD.
